Harbor Freight Lewiston - promotional ads and opening hours

Shops locations Harbor Freight - Lewiston

Location/AddressOpening hours
1911 21st St
Lewiston
ID 83501
United States

Lewiston - shops of other popular brands

Promotional ads Home Depot
Promotional ads Ace Hardware
Promotional ads Michaels